My son was using a Kubota M125X to clear a path through a wind row that contains old stumps, limbs, dirt etc. He was using the front end loader with a bucket on it to push eveything out of the way. The loader uses a skid steer quick attach to hold the bucket onto the front end loader. Some how the left side of the bucket came off the quick attach. Apparently a limb hit the skid steer release handle. This caused the left bracket that fits into the bucket to bend. In other words, the loader can not be used with out replacing this bracket. Unfortunately, this bracket consist of the left bracket, right bracket and the bar in between (A rather large part).
I have not contacted the dealer yet. The tractor is about a year old with only about 170 hrs on it. What is everyone's opinion on this?? Should the dealer try to help me out or should I just grin and bear it?
My only thing is for the amount of dollars spent on this tractor, this quick attach skid steer handle is easy to release. It does not lock like the bush hog loaders that I have used in the past.
